Main Industry Applications

Sodium Ascorbate secures structural stability and nutritional value across various demanding market sectors. As a result, it remains a top choice for diverse B2B formulations:

  • Meat & Poultry Processing: It rapidly accelerates the reduction of nitrites to nitric oxide. Consequently, it strongly stabilizes the red color of cured meats and actively prevents carcinogenic nitrosamine formation.
  • Dietary Supplements: Manufacturers heavily rely on it for high-dose Vitamin C products. Its buffered nature prevents gastric irritation, appealing directly to health-conscious consumers.
  • Food & Beverages: It acts as a powerful antioxidant to significantly extend overall shelf life. Additionally, it pairs perfectly with other plant-based extracts to protect delicate flavor profiles from oxidation.
  • Cosmetics: R&D teams strategically use it in topical skincare formulations to safely promote collagen synthesis without causing severe acid burns.

Technical Description: Sodium Ascorbate Wholesale

Chemically, manufacturers synthesize this essential compound (C6H7NaO6) by completely dissolving pure ascorbic acid in water and reacting it with sodium bicarbonate. The resulting molecular structure provides exactly 89% active ascorbic acid and 11% sodium by weight. Read more about E301 regulations.

For food technologists, its primary industrial advantage lies in its reliable redox potential. Unlike free ascorbic acid variants, which can drastically lower formulation pH and permanently damage meat protein water-binding capacity, this sodium salt maintains a perfectly stable environment. However, technologists must protect the aqueous solutions from intense light, extreme heat, and heavy trace metals to prevent premature oxidation in the mixing tanks.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the exact difference between Sodium Ascorbate and standard Ascorbic Acid?

Standard Ascorbic Acid possesses a very low pH (2.0-3.0) and a remarkably tart, acidic taste. Conversely, Sodium Ascorbate is chemically buffered with sodium, resulting in a perfectly neutral pH (7.0-8.0) and a slightly saline flavor. Therefore, R&D teams strictly prefer it for low-acid food formulations, delicate meat curing, and stomach-friendly dietary capsules.

Exactly how much sodium does this specific additive contain?

By molecular weight, it contains exactly 11.1% sodium. This mathematically means every 1,000 mg of the bulk powder delivers roughly 889 mg of pure Vitamin C and 111 mg of sodium. Consequently, this exact, standardized ratio helps your technologists accurately calculate strict sodium limits for clean-label nutritional panels.
